FAQ's of Calcium Hexaboride (12007-99-7):


Q: How is Calcium Hexaboride typically used in industrial applications?

A: Calcium Hexaboride is primarily used as an additive for alloys, especially boron steel and special alloys. It is also utilized in the production of wear-resistant and refractory materials, abrasive products, and as a component in semiconductor devices.

Q: What are the benefits of using Calcium Hexaboride in manufacturing processes?

A: Calcium Hexaboride offers extraordinary high hardness, supreme thermal conductivity, and good electrical conductivity. These properties contribute to enhanced durability, stability, and efficiency in the final products, especially for materials exposed to high temperatures or requiring wear resistance.

Q: How should Calcium Hexaboride be stored for maximum shelf life?

A: To ensure a 24-month shelf life, Calcium Hexaboride should be stored in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area with its container tightly closed. This maintains the compound's stability and prevents degradation or contamination.
